Ingredients
- – 680g chicken breast, cut in half lengthwise to cook faster (1.5 lb)
- – 30g gluten-free flour (2 tbsp)
- – 2.5g salt (1/2 tsp)
- – 1.25g ground black pepper (1/4 tsp)
- – 30ml olive oil (2 tbsp)
- – 227g can of roasted artichoke hearts, drained (8 oz)
- – 85g sun-dried tomatoes (3 oz)
- – 45g capers, drained (3 tbsp)
- – 30ml lemon juice, freshly squeezed (2 tbsp)
- – 15g gluten-free flour (1 tbsp)
- – 240ml almond milk, or any other milk (1 cup)
- – 15g freshly chopped parsley (1 tbsp)
Instructions
- In a medium-sized bowl, combine 2 tablespoons of gluten-free flour with 1/2 teaspoon of salt and 1/4 teaspoon of ground black pepper. Dredge each piece of the 1.5 pounds of chicken breast in the seasoned flour mixture.
- Warm 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large frying pan over medium heat. Place the chicken in the pan and cook for approximately 10-12 minutes on each side, or until thoroughly cooked. If necessary, cook in separate batches to prevent overcrowding. Transfer to a plate and cover to maintain warmth.
- In the meantime, in a small bowl, blend the remaining 1 tablespoon of gluten-free flour with 1 cup of almond milk until smooth.
- Using the same heated skillet, add the drained roasted artichoke hearts, sun-dried tomatoes, and drained capers. Cook for around 2 minutes, then pour in the milk mixture and add the lemon juice, whisking until well combined.
- As the sauce begins to thicken, place the chicken back into the pan. Allow it to simmer for a few minutes until heated through.
- Serve hot, topped with freshly chopped parsley.
Notes
- For a richer sauce, use coconut milk or regular dairy milk instead of almond milk.
- Ensure artichoke hearts and capers are well drained to avoid a watery sauce.
- Enhance the dish’s flavor by adding garlic powder or Italian seasoning as desired.
